Choosing the Right Western Blot Transfer Apparatus for Your Business

With various models and technologies available, selecting the ideal western blot transfer apparatus requires careful consideration of your business needs. Factors to evaluate include:

1. Transfer Method and Capacity

Depending on your throughput requirements, options include tank transfer systems for small-scale research and semi-dry or dry transfer equipment for high-throughput laboratories.

2. Compatibility and Flexibility

Ensure the apparatus supports different membrane types (PVDF, nitrocellulose) and gel formats to maximize versatility.

3. Automation and User Interface

Modern systems with automated transfer controls, intuitive interfaces, and programmable protocols enhance workflow efficiency and reduce training time.

4. Data Management and Integration

Systems with digital documentation capabilities facilitate compliance, data tracking, and integration with laboratory management software.

5. Cost and Maintenance

Consider initial investment, operational costs, durability, and ease of maintenance to ensure long-term ROI.
